Latest Patents
Marcia's latest patents focus on innovative methods to increase the bioavailability of flavan-3-ols. The first patent, titled "Increasing the bioavailability of flavan-3-ols by polyphenols," describes a composition that utilizes at least one polyphenolic compound to enhance the absorption of flavan-3-ols. The second patent, "Increasing the bioavailability of flavan-3-ols with carbohydrates with a low glycemic index," outlines a method that incorporates carbohydrates with a glycemic index of less than 50 to improve the bioavailability of flavan-3-ols.
